Transaction 521ebd44e74609a2a876119b06195c9eab456c68e8c712e1d3af2eef28907589
1 Input
2 Outputs
- 521ebd44e74609a2a876119b06195c9eab456c68e8c712e1d3af2eef28907589:0
- 521ebd44e74609a2a876119b06195c9eab456c68e8c712e1d3af2eef28907589:1
value 30176000
address 176hFbVgLrw2ewZqkddLytT8F63D2zdyoj
value 157796192
address 12TjY6ahxwE5gL1ypSCGnyHvPLdaaG8N9w